How Can You Assess the Durability of a Sit Down Lawn Mower?
To assess the durability of a sit-down lawn mower, you should examine its construction, components, user reviews, and maintenance requirements.
-
Construction materials: Durable lawn mowers typically feature solid steel or reinforced plastic in their frames and decks. Steel offers strength and resistance to wear. Reinforced plastic helps prevent rusting while still providing necessary support.
-
Engine reliability: The engine plays a crucial role in the mower’s longevity. Look for engines with high-quality brands, such as Kohler or Briggs & Stratton, known for their durability and performance. Reliable engines often have a longer warranty period, which indicates manufacturer confidence in their products.
-
Cutting deck design: A well-designed cutting deck affects both performance and durability. Seek a deck with a robust design and proper airflow for an efficient cut. Research shows that a deck with a reinforced design can withstand rough terrain better, as per a study by Gardener’s Supply Company in 2021.
-
User reviews: Customer feedback provides insights into the mower’s real-world performance. Look for ratings that highlight the mower’s lifespan, ease of repairs, and parts availability. A study by Consumer Reports in 2020 ranked durable mowers based on customer satisfaction and longevity.
-
Maintenance requirements: A mower that requires less frequent maintenance is often more durable. Check the ease of access to engine and blade components. Regular maintenance such as oil changes and blade sharpening can prolong the mower’s life, making it essential to consider designed accessibility for these tasks.
-
Warranty terms: A longer warranty period often reflects the manufacturer’s confidence in the mower’s durability. Look for warranties that cover both parts and labor. For example, mowers with a three-year warranty tend to be more reliable than those with a shorter warranty.
Evaluating these aspects will help you determine the durability of a sit-down lawn mower effectively.

What Maintenance Practices Ensure Longevity for Sit Down Lawn Mowers?
The maintenance practices that ensure longevity for sit-down lawn mowers include regular inspections, proper cleaning, and timely part replacements.
- Regular oil changes
- Air filter cleaning and replacement
- Spark plug inspection and replacement
- Blade sharpening and replacement
- Battery maintenance
- Tire pressure checks
- Fuel system care
- Deck cleaning and rust prevention
Effective maintenance practices play a crucial role in the performance and lifespan of sit-down lawn mowers.
-
Regular Oil Changes: Regular oil changes for sit-down lawn mowers help in maintaining engine health. Oil lubricates engine components and reduces friction. According to the American Society for Testing and Materials (ASTM), changing the oil every 50 hours of operation can significantly extend engine life. Neglecting oil changes can lead to engine wear and reduced performance.
-
Air Filter Cleaning and Replacement: Cleaning and replacing air filters in sit-down lawn mowers ensures proper airflow to the engine. A clean air filter prevents dirt and debris from entering the engine, enhancing combustion efficiency. The Environmental Protection Agency (EPA) suggests checking the air filter every 25 hours of operation and replacing it when necessary.
-
Spark Plug Inspection and Replacement: Inspecting and replacing spark plugs is essential for maintaining smooth engine operation. A worn spark plug can hinder starting and cause uneven engine performance. The Briggs & Stratton Corporation recommends inspecting spark plugs every season and replacing them if the electrodes are worn or damaged.
-
Blade Sharpening and Replacement: Sharpening and replacing blades on sit-down lawn mowers is crucial for an even cut and overall lawn health. Dull blades can tear grass instead of cutting it cleanly, which may lead to lawn diseases. According to research from Purdue University, maintaining sharp blades contributes to better grass health and aesthetics.
-
Battery Maintenance: Battery maintenance is vital, especially for electric or gas mowers with electric starters. Regularly checking the battery terminals for corrosion and ensuring clean connections can prevent starting issues. The Battery Council International emphasizes that maintaining battery health prolongs its lifespan and reliability.
-
Tire Pressure Checks: Regular checks on tire pressure optimize mower performance and ensure a level cut. Incorrect tire pressure can affect traction and maneuverability. The Tire Industry Association suggests keeping the tires inflated to the manufacturer’s recommended pressure to ensure longevity and safety.
-
Fuel System Care: Caring for the fuel system involves using fresh fuel and a fuel stabilizer for long-term storage. Stale fuel can cause engine issues and hard starts. According to the National Institute of Standards and Technology, using proper fuel management techniques minimizes the risk of fuel-related problems in lawn mowers.
-
Deck Cleaning and Rust Prevention: Cleaning the mower deck regularly prevents grass buildup and rust. Rust can lead to structural issues over time. The University of Missouri Extension recommends scraping off debris and applying a rust inhibitor after cleaning to enhance the mower’s lifespan.
Incorporating these maintenance practices will ensure long-term functionality and reliability for sit-down lawn mowers.
What Common Problems Do Sit Down Lawn Mowers Face and What Solutions Exist?
Sit-down lawn mowers commonly face several issues, including mechanical failures, fuel system problems, and maintenance challenges. Solutions exist to address these issues, enabling effective operation.
- Mechanical failures
- Fuel system problems
- Blade issues
- Electrical problems
- Tire wear and damage
- Maintenance challenges
To better understand the complexities of these problems and their potential solutions, we will delve into each issue in detail.
-
Mechanical Failures: Mechanical failures occur when components of the mower malfunction due to wear and tear or manufacturing defects. Common failures include engine issues and transmission problems. According to a study by John Deere, regular checks can prevent 75% of mechanical failures. For example, lubricating moving parts helps extend the life of components. A well-documented case in 2021 demonstrated that regular maintenance on a popular model reduced engine failures by 30%.
-
Fuel System Problems: Fuel system problems arise from dirty fuel filters or fuel lines, leading to engine stalling. The U.S. Environmental Protection Agency (EPA) indicates that fuel quality directly affects engine performance. Cleaning fuel filters every 100 operating hours can enhance mower longevity. Implementing a fuel stabilizer can prevent fuel degradation, which often occurs in unused mowers.
-
Blade Issues: Blade issues include dull or damaged blades that can result in poor cutting performance. According to research by the Institute of Agriculture and Natural Resources, dull blades can increase mowing time by 50%. Sharpening the blades regularly and ensuring proper alignment can markedly improve cutting efficiency and extend the mower’s lifespan.
-
Electrical Problems: Electrical problems often manifest as battery failures or faulty wiring. Symptoms may include difficulty starting the mower or malfunctioning lights. A report by the Consumer Product Safety Commission found that properly maintaining battery connections can enhance the reliability of electric systems. Regular inspections can identify and mitigate potential electrical hazards.
-
Tire Wear and Damage: Tires are prone to wear from rough terrain and improper inflation. The Rubber Manufacturers Association states that under-inflated tires can reduce mower stability and increase fuel consumption. Regular tire inspections and maintaining recommended tire pressure can help avoid excessive wear and improve overall performance.
-
Maintenance Challenges: Maintenance challenges stem from the complexity of repair tasks or lack of user knowledge. Some users may struggle to perform routine maintenance. The National Association of State Departments of Agriculture recommends users familiarize themselves with the owner’s manual for proper care instructions. Online resources and local community workshops can also offer valuable support.
These points illustrate the common problems faced by sit-down lawn mowers and the practical solutions available to users, enhancing the longevity and performance of these machines.
